Q » How do dairy cows produce milk?
30 Oct, 2025
A » Dairy cows produce milk primarily after giving birth. This process begins with conception and pregnancy, lasting about nine months. Following calving, the cow's mammary glands are stimulated to produce milk due to hormonal changes. Dairy farmers then milk cows regularly to maintain lactation. Proper nutrition, management, and care ensure cows continue producing milk efficiently for extended periods. Regular veterinary checks also support a healthy and productive milk yield.
